Output 63c00580606429037634aacda532d98efbb09eff1b09824f6a0c2e198478e01a:1
- value
- 6394564
- script pubkey
- OP_0 OP_PUSHBYTES_20 d39f117f6d95c324bf4be842a9e29afefe7e01e8
- address
- tb1q6w03zlmdjhpjf06tapp2nc56lml8uq0gl7pew8
- transaction
- 63c00580606429037634aacda532d98efbb09eff1b09824f6a0c2e198478e01a